What is the best color for urban planter boxes if I want them to absorb more heat?

If you want your urban planter boxes to absorb more heat, the unequivocal answer is to choose dark colors. Dark hues, particularly black, charcoal gray, and deep brown, are superior because they have a low albedo, meaning they absorb most wavelengths of visible light and convert that energy into heat. This absorbed warmth is then transferred to the soil and root zone, creating a microclimate that can be beneficial for plant growth, especially in cooler urban environments or during early and late growing seasons.

The science is straightforward: lighter colors, like white or beige, reflect sunlight and therefore stay cooler. While this can be advantageous in extremely hot climates to prevent root scorch, for the goal of heat absorption, dark is most effective. Materials also play a role; metal and dense composite planters in dark colors will conduct and retain heat more efficiently than lighter materials like light-colored wood.

When applying this principle, consider your local climate. In predominantly cool or temperate city settings, a dark planter can provide a crucial few degrees of extra warmth to extend the growing season for vegetables like tomatoes and peppers. However, in very hot, sunny climates, careful monitoring is needed to ensure the soil doesn't overheat and stress the plants. Pairing dark-colored planters with adequate drainage and proper watering practices is key to harnessing the thermal benefits while maintaining healthy plant roots. Ultimately, selecting a black or dark gray planter is a simple, effective strategy to passively increase heat for a more productive urban garden.
